The Welcome to Fabulous Las Vegas sign is a Las Vegas landmark funded in May 1959 and erected soon after by Western Neon. The sign was designed by Betty Willis at the request of Ted Rogich, a local salesman, who sold it to Clark County, Nevada.[1]

Coverage[]

The Welcome to Fabulous Las Vegas sign is featured in Sin City Meltdown.

It was introduced in 100 years when fine grains of windblown sand are erasing the welcome sign that once greeted visitors to the city of Las Vegas.

Its fate is revealed in 200 years when a desert thunderstorm rumbles in Las Vegas and since flash floods are common, flood waters have rust to spread into the support beams after 200 years of rushing water past the Las Vegas Sign. As another weather hazard comes into play, the wind blows up to 90 miles per hour in Las Vegas, making a powerful gust catches the city's old greeting sign like a sail. It torques the weakened supports to the breaking point making the sign falls flat on the empty crumbling roadway.
